Death of a child

If you are consulting this section following the death of a child, please accept our condolences. We know that this is a very difficult time for you and we will do everything in our power to facilitate the processing of your file.

Payment of certain benefits ends following the death of a child. If the death occurs while paternity, parental, welcome and support or adoption benefits are being paid, parents cease being eligible for the benefits as of the end of the second week after the week of the death.

Payment of maternity benefits is not affected by the death of a child. Maternity benefits are granted to mothers to help them recover following pregnancy and childbirth. However, if the mother has no weeks or just one week of benefits left, she could receive one or two weeks of parental benefits, depending on the situation.

For information about the benefits payable if there is a termination of pregnancy, consult the section Benefits When There is a Termination of Pregnancy.

Important

You must inform us of your child’s date of death as soon as possible so that we can update your file and make any necessary adjustments. Please contact the Centre de service à la clientèle for information about the processing of your file.
